What does 24-Hour Care actually include on a typical day?

A caregiver is present for personal hygiene, bathing, dressing, toileting, and grooming. They prepare meals, manage medications, help with mobility and transfers, and provide companionship. They watch for falls, confusion, changes in appetite or mood, and document what you need to know. At night, they stay alert and awake while your parent sleeps, ready to help if they need the bathroom, get confused, or fall.

Is 24-Hour Care covered by Medicare or insurance?

24-Hour Care is private pay. Medicare covers home health aide visits only for medical necessity and usually for a few hours a week, not around-the-clock presence. We can discuss pricing, help you understand what 24-Hour Care costs, and talk about how families typically structure the arrangement. Many people use a combination of insurance-covered services and private care to fill the gaps.

What is the difference between 24-Hour Care and a home health aide?

A home health aide typically visits a few hours a week, scheduled by insurance or Medicare for medical reasons. 24-Hour Care means someone is there continuously, sleeping in your home or present full-time. The difference is presence. With 24-Hour Care, your parent isn't alone during high-risk hours. We also tend to know your parent's patterns deeply and catch subtle changes faster because we're there consistently.
